ipx server static
For CoreBuilder 9000: Applies to Layer 3 switching modules only.
Defines a static IPX server.
Valid Minimum Abbreviation
ipx ser st
Important Considerations
■
Static servers remain in the table until you remove them, until you
remove the corresponding interface, or until you remove the route to
the corresponding network address.
■
A static server must have an IPX network address that corresponds to
a configured interface or to a static route. If an interface goes down,
any static servers on that interface are permanently removed from the
server table until the interface comes back up.
■
Static servers take precedence over dynamically learned servers to the
same destination. You can have a maximum of 32 static servers.
■
Before you define static servers on the system, first define at least one
IPX interface. See “ipx interface define”earlier in this chapter for more
details.
